Keio Corporation has built a new set of 5000 series rolling stock fi tted with seats that are reconfi gurable to suit diff erent types of train operation, with longitudinal seating for nor- mal operation and cross seating on trains that use designated seating. Th e rolling stock com- menced operation on September 29, 2017 on the Keio Line where they are being used for conventional services. Hitachi also developed and installed integrated safety equipment that is able to adapt fl exibly to the safety functions expected to be used for through-train services. Th e design of the rolling stock followed the design concept from the design brand upgrade project of the Sotetsu Group, using Navy Blue, the new feature color for the Sotetsu Main Line, for the exterior.
